Three Figures

  • Sukūrimo data1961
  • Matmenys36.0 x 46.0 cm
The artwork Three Figures by William Brice, created in 1961, is a captivating oil on canvas piece that showcases the artist's unique style and technique. Measuring 36 x 46 cm, this painting is a representation of three naked individuals on a beach, each facing away from the others. The setting includes a rocky outcropping and sand, with a cloudy blue sky in the background.

Artistic Style and Influences

William Brice's work is characterized by his use of bold colors and abstract forms. In Three Figures, he employs a more subdued color palette, focusing on earthy tones to convey a sense of serenity and intimacy. The painting's composition, with the three figures positioned in a triangular formation, creates a sense of balance and harmony. Key Features:

Conservation and Exhibition

Three Figures is part of the collection at the Hirshhorn Museum and Sculpture Garden in the United States.
